South Dakota Code § 7-6-2

Form and casting of ballots for selection of county seat--Application of general election law

The ballots used at said election for the location of the county seat shall be in such form as the county commissioners shall prescribe, and such ballots shall be separate from the ballots cast and used for the election of state, county, and other officers, and shall be received and deposited in a separate ballot box, and the municipality receiving a majority of all the votes cast shall be the county seat, and the votes cast shall be returned, canvassed, and certified as provided by law for the return of votes at any general election.
